Transaction e76a2e9e9244ee474b8f9b2324d43aafbc8bbbdca10f0d0d67fa40ed9fd5a8b2
1 Input
1 Output
-
e76a2e9e9244ee474b8f9b2324d43aafbc8bbbdca10f0d0d67fa40ed9fd5a8b2:0
- value
- 696566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5cfe3f8dee74ba0c693acdd2f24cb44e8484801 OP_EQUAL
- address
- 3MBYttZyRsxYZFf2BxhtNSPryLZP38vrhM